我正在尝试创建一个查询,该查询将返回按日期访问过某些内容的不同用户数的结果。现在我有一个查询,它将显示2列,第一列是日期,第二列是用户名。它将列出在特定日期访问应用程序的所有不同用户,但每个用户都有自己不同的行。下面是执行此操作的查询:
SELECT DISTINCT logdate, User AS ReportUser
FROM table
WHERE appname='abcd1234' AND logdate >=DATE-30
我尝试过将COUNT()放在User周围,但它指出所选的非聚合值必须是相关组的一部分。
你知道如何让这个查询只显示过
我创建了一个基于登录时使用的电子邮件显示用户数据的profileController,我使用Laravel提供的身份验证功能并创建了一个存储用户数据的用户表,然后我想根据登录时收到的电子邮件显示用户数据?有什么改进的建议吗?我拿不到用户数据。 <?php
namespace App\Http\Controllers;
use Illuminate\Support\Facades\Auth;
use App\Profil;
use Illuminate\Http\Request;
class profilController extends Controller
{
pub
这是我的投票模式:
namespace App;
use Illuminate\Database\Eloquent\Model;
class Vote extends Model
{
public function user(){
return $this->belongsTo('App\User');
}
public function options(){
return $this->hasMany('App\Option');
}
}
这是我的选择模式:
namespace App;
我有一个for循环,当我添加额外的一行代码时,由于某种原因,这个循环被忽略了。我已经独立测试了这行代码和for循环,两者都能正常工作。
代码如下:
onestar <- 0
twostar <- 0
threestar <- 0
fourstar <- 0
paste(ccdata[1,3],"*")
for (i in 1:ncol(ccdata))
{
for (j in 1:nrow(ccdata)){#iterate down the list
cat(ccdata[j,i])
if (ccdata[j,i
在我的路由文件中,我将在当前会话中获取用户,并呈现概要文件html:
app.get('/profile', isLoggedIn, function(req, res) {
res.render('profile.html', {
user : req.user // get the user out of session and pass to template
});
});
profile.html需要显示用户数据,例如用户名。html中显示的数据在vue组件中指定:
var app =
我正在尝试编写一个ec2用户数据脚本,该脚本将从私有s3桶中提取一个文件。ec2实例位于多个区域,我认为这消除了使用桶策略限制对VPC的访问(在我的原型中工作得很好,但在第二个区域崩溃)的可能性。
基于这里和其他地方的建议,似乎应该起作用的方法是给ec2实例一个访问s3桶的IAM角色。事实上,这对我来说几乎是可行的。但是,在用户数据脚本运行的时候并不是这样。
我的用户数据脚本有一个while循环,它检查我试图从s3下载的文件是否存在,并将继续重试5分钟。如果我在该窗口中手动登录,并在该5分钟的窗口中手动运行精确的aws命令,用户数据脚本就会像预期的那样成功,但它本身永远不会成功。
apt in
我有一个用户I列表,每个订单都有一行,给出订单I,并为订单提供平台。
我想要理解
仅在一个平台上购物的唯一用户数量,
在应用程序和其他平台(网络移动或网络桌面)上购物的独特用户数量。
我只设法得到用户的平台总数,但我想了解用户在平台上重叠的地方。
我希望有人能给我指明这个方向。
样本数据:
User ID Order no Platform
1 12 App
2 123 Web - Mobile
2 234 App
3 345 Web - Mobile
5 456 App
5 567 Web - Desktop
5 678 Web - Mob
我尝试在使用passportjs成功登录后将用户数据传递到仪表板页面。
post方法工作得很好,但将用户数据传递给index.handlebars并不成功。
谁可以检查我的代码,并提供可能的解决方案。
//This is my POST method
app.post("/login", passport.authenticate('local', {
succesRedirect: "/",
failureRedirect: "/user/login"
}),
function (req, res) {